In an era heavily focused on transition to ultra-premium efficiency classes like IE4 and IE5, standard efficiency IE1 motors remain a vital cornerstone of global industrial operations. For B2B procurement managers, system integrators, and heavy machinery manufacturers, IE1 motors offer an unmatched balance of cost-effectiveness, mechanical simplicity, and rugged reliability in specific applications.
Under the IEC 60034-30-1 standard, IE1 defines the baseline standard efficiency for single-speed, three-phase induction motors. While high-efficiency motors are mandated for continuous-duty (S1) applications in many regulated regions, IE1 motors are highly sought after globally for intermittent duty cycles (S2, S3, S6), auxiliary systems, and environments where high ambient temperatures or severe operating conditions make expensive high-efficiency electronics economically unviable.

IE1 defines "Standard Efficiency" under the international IEC 60034-30-1 standard for single-speed, three-phase induction motors. IE2 represents "High Efficiency," IE3 is "Premium Efficiency," and IE4 is "Super Premium Efficiency." While higher classes offer reduced energy consumption, IE1 motors remain highly popular due to their lower initial purchase cost, mechanical simplicity, and excellent performance in applications with low duty cycles or intermittent operation.
In the EU and North America, strict minimum energy performance standards (MEPS) mandate IE3 or IE4 efficiency classes for most continuous-duty (S1) industrial applications. However, IE1 motors are still permitted for specific applications, including intermittent duty cycles (S2, S3, S6), explosion-proof motors, completely integrated motors (where the motor cannot be tested separately), and as direct replacement parts for legacy systems where upgrading to a larger high-efficiency frame size is mechanically impossible.
